According to a live fan report from the WWE non-televised live event on Saturday night in Providence, Rhode Island, WWE Superstar and leader of The Wyatt Family, Bray Wyatt, may have suffered an injury during his match.
During the six-man tag-team match, Wyatt was reportedly chasing Darren Young of The Prime Time Players out of the ring until he landed wrong and immediately went to the ground before ultimately crawling back into the ring.
While The Wyatt Family would go on to finish and win the match, the referee did throw up the dreaded “X” symbol to signal a quick finish to the contest.
After the match was over, Erick Rowan and Luke Harper of The Wyatt Family carried Bray Wyatt out of the ring. Additionally, an eye-witness account from a fan in attendance claims Bray appeared to be in what was described as “obvious pain.”
